Oberaigner Sprinter 6x6 with KrugXP cabin
Well it's taken long enough but my vehicle is basically ready to ship out from Germany. LWB Oberaigner 6x6 Sprinter with a 4.7m long cabin built by KrugXP. I saw it last week at Hellgeth Engineering, who are assisting with the joining of the two parts and who have put in some tow points and additional fuel tanks for me (I went with plastic in the end). So it now has 200L total capacity.
It weighs in at a shade under 5,500kg empty, so should max out at about 6,400kgs once I've loaded it up and with all water (250L) and diesel tanks full. GVW is 7 tonnes so I'm well within that.
My concern now is the Euro 3, 4 cylinder 2,143cc engine was struggling on long inclines but I'm looking into mild ECU remapping for more torque - nothing major, nothing which will overstress the engine, which is available in several road cars tuned to much higher torque and power outputs than in the Sprinter.
